This is our quarterly #ForHernando Serve Day.

#ForHernando is a movement that transcends just one church and has the potential to transform our community. This fall, Crosspoint Church will once again be seeking to BE THE CHURCH in Hernando County as we practically serve people and organizations by meeting real, physical needs. Our goal is to show them that they matter to us and more importantly they matter to God!

We will ALL meet at the church at 8 am on Saturday, Feb 21st, 2026, to huddle up, get our groups together and pray before heading out to our project sites.

Please wear your #ForHernando shirt if you have one. Help us steward our funds well by not taking a new shirt if you do not need one. 
 
Once you pick a team you’ll be added to a group. Expect to hear from your Team Lead as we lead up to the event date. All updates and details will be shared there. 

Projects


Life Center Team

  • This team will spend the morning completing projects around the facility including: painting, landscaping, general repairs.
  • Please bring gloves, eye-protection, wear closed-toe work shoes and clothing. 
  • Some hand tools and gardening tools will be helpful. 
  • The Life Center is a shelter for single moms and their children. Life Center of Hernando, Inc. provides needed social services using a faith based model, to parents of minor children in Hernando County and the surrounding areas. The services offered promotes self-sufficiency and independence.
     

Ramp Building Team

  • This team will help to build a wheelchair ramp at a home of a local resident. 
  • Please bring gloves, eye-protection, wear closed-toe work shoes and clothing. 


First Responder Thank You Team

  • This team will write thank you and prayer cards for local first responders and deliver cards and treats to fire stations and offices. 
  • Please bring treats to share (cookies, candy, snacks) 
  • We'll provide blank cards.
